Beyond a Steel Sky has been delayed on consoles, but not everywhere

Microids and Revolution Software have announced that the console release of Beyond a Steel Sky has been delay, but only in certain regions.

In a statement released on Twitter, publisher Microids explained that the delay was due to “worldwide logistical issues and constraints beyond our control”, which is hardly a common reason for delay due to COVID-19 nearly two years ago.

Oddly enough, this delay is very region-specific, with different territories getting their console versions of Beyond a Steel Sky at very different times. Here’s a rundown of when and where Beyond a Steel Sky was released:

  • UK
    • Nintendo Switch – Digital – November 30
    • PS4, PS5, Xbox One, Xbox Series X | S, Nintendo Switch – Digital and Physical – December 7
  • North America
    • Nintendo Switch – Digital – December 7
    • PS4, PS5, Xbox One, Xbox Series X | S, Nintendo Switch – Digital and Physical – December 14
  • Australia and New Zealand
    • PS4, PS5, Xbox One, Xbox Series X | S, Nintendo Switch – Digital – November 30
    • PS4, PS5, Xbox One, Xbox Series X | S, Nintendo Switch – Physical – December 17
  • Europe
    • PS4, PS5, Xbox One, Xbox Series X | S, Nintendo Switch – Digital and Physical – November 30
